How Our Laundry Room Water Removal Service Actually Works

When you call our team for laundry room water removal, we’ll send a technician to assess the damage and develop a customized plan to get your space back to normal.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water, dry the area, and prevent further damage. Our goal is to reduce disruption to your daily routine and get your laundry room up and running as soon as possible.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technician will evaluate the damage and find out the best course of action. This may involve using spec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and assess the extent of the damage. Within 60 minutes, we’ll have a plan in place to get your laundry room back to normal.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ract water from the affected area. This is typically done within 2-3 hours,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team will use specialized equipment to dry the area and prevent further damage. This may involve using desiccants, fans, and dehumidifiers to remove moisture from the air and surfaces.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ning

Once the area is dry, we’ll sanitize and clean the space to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This may involve using antimicrobial treatments and specialized cleaning solutions.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ration

Our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is safe and dry. We’ll make any necessary repairs and restore your laundry room to its original condition.

Laundry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in the washing machine Yes No You can likely fix the leak yourself with a DIY repair kit.
Standing water in the laundry room due to a clogged drain No Yes Standing water can be a serious health hazard and needs professional attention to prevent mold and mildew growth.
Visible signs of water damage or warping on the flooring No Yes Water damage can be a costly problem to fix, and our team can help you prevent further damage and restore your flooring to its original condition.
Unusual sounds or vibrations in the laundry room No Yes Unusual sounds or vibrations can show a hidden leak or other problem that needs professional attention.
Visible signs of mold or mildew in the laundry room No Yes Mold and mildew can be a serious health hazard and need professional attention to remove and prevent future growth.
Laundry room water damage due to a burst pipe or other emergency No Yes In emergency situations, it’s essential to call a professional to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.

Laundry Room Water Removal Cost in Easton, MA

The cost of laundry room water removal in Easton, MA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a free estimate and help you navigate the claims process with your insurance company.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water present.
Sanitizing and cleaning $200 – $1,000 The extent of the damage and the type of cleaning required.
Repairs and restoration $1,000 – $5,000 The type and extent of the repairs required.
Equipment rental and labor $500 – $2,000 The type and duration of the equipment rental and labor required.
Insurance claims help Free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.
Emergency services (after-hours or weekend) 10% – 20% surcharge The cost of emergency services may be higher due to the urgency of the situation.

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ate and help you navigate the claims process with your insurance company.

Common Questions About Laundry Room Water Removal

How long does laundry room water removal take?

The length of time it takes to complete laundry room water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. But, our team can typically complete the job within 3-5 days.

Do I need to move out of my home during the restoration process?

No, you do not need to move out of your home during the restoration process. Our team will work with you to reduce disruption to your daily routine and ensure that your home is safe and habitable during the restoration process.

Will my insurance company cover the costs of laundry room water removal?

Yes, your insurance company may cover the costs of laundry room water removal, depending on the terms of your policy and the circumstances surrounding the damage.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.

How do I prevent laundry room water damage in the future?

There are several steps you can take to prevent laundry room water damage in the future, including checking your washing machine and dryer regularly for leaks, using a water sensor to detect hidden moisture, and keeping your laundry room well-ventilated.
